As a mother and psychologist, Fatima found herself on a deep journey of self-discovery when her son was diagnosed with mild autism. Initially, the news felt like a pause button on life, leaving her struggling with a wave of emotions and societal misunderstandings about autism.

Facing the Misunderstandings

In those early days, well-meaning voices urged Fatima to hide her son’s condition as if it were a shameful secret. The typical attitude treated autism like a contagious illness, something to be hidden and cured. It was a painful realisation that the path ahead would be an uphill battle against misconceptions deeply rooted in her community.

Embracing Neurodiversity

However, as time passed, Fatima realised that her son’s autism was not a burden to be carried but an integral part of his identity – a unique aspect woven into the fabric of his being. Gradually, she accepted this truth, and a sense of pride grew within her. She is the mother of an autistic child, and she wears this identity with honour.

A Transformative Journey

Raising a child with special needs in a society that often misunderstands neurodiversity is a significant challenge. Still, it was a transformative journey that deepened Fatima’s faith and enriched her perspective on life. Her resilience has grown stronger with each obstacle they have faced, and her commitment to advocacy has intensified.

True Essence of Awareness

During Autism Awareness Month, Fatima reflects on the true essence of awareness – acceptance. Before seeking treatments, therapies, or specialised schools, we must embrace these extraordinary individuals as valued members of our society. As a psychologist, she has witnessed firsthand the mistaken belief that autism is a temporary phase or a condition that can be “cured” through alternative remedies. However, the truth is that autism is a lifelong neurological condition, and the focus should be on empowering and supporting these individuals, not attempting to “fix” them.
